Linux环境下Maven服务器搭建

本博客是一个纯技术交流博客,写出来的文章是帮大家解决一些问题,或让大家有个参考和思路,更多技术分享请关注http://blog.36dr.net,有任何问题可与我邮件[email protected]

Maven基本准备

Maven服务器下载

官网地址:http://download.sonatype.com/nexus/oss/nexus-2.11.1-01-bundle.zip,通过此地址下载maven.

$ unzip nexus-2.11.1-01-bundle.zip

然后解压文件会得到nexus-2.6.0-05和sonatype-work。

Maven安装和启动

进入Maven解压nexus目录,然后执行:

$ nexus-2.11.1-01/bin/nexus start

在安装时可能会遇到错误,比如环境变量未配置时请配置一下:

RUN_AS_USER=root   
NEXUS_HOME=$HOME/nexus-2.0.3/

启动成功之后,通过http://ip:8081/nexus/index.html访问maven仓库,默认管理员账户和密码:admin/admin123

修改Maven工作目录sonatype-work位置

默认Maven安装之后会生成sonatype-work目录,此目录将作为默认的jar文件放置处。为了防止后期不停的累加导致Maven仓库变大同时也不利于后期对Maven的管理。
--待定--

修改Maven仓库访问的端口

首先查看Maven是否正在运行

$ ps -ef |grep nexus

然后通过kill杀掉进程,然后修改maven配置文件

$ cd $HOME/nexus-2.11.1-01/conf
$ vi nexus.properties

把application-port=8081 修改为application-port=8981

然后访问:http://IP:8981/nexus/index.html#welcome

仓库添加

  • 个人发布库流程

你可能感兴趣的:(Linux环境下Maven服务器搭建)